Roasted Apple & Garlic Turkey

Recipe: Roasted Apple & Garlic Turkey

Summary: A simple yet tasty roasted turkey recipe

Ingredients

SOFTWARE:
  • 1 8-12 LB. Young Turkey
  • 6 Cans Frozen Apple Juice Concentrate
  • 3 Boxes Chicken Stock
  • 1 LB. + 1 TBS Kosher Salt
  • 1/4 Cup Black Pepper Corns
  • 3 LB Ice
  • 1 LB Brown Sugar
  • 1 Bottle Teriyaki Sauce
  • 2 TBS. Vegetable or Canola Oil
  • 1 Whole Garlic Bulb
  • 1 small Red Onion
  • 1 Macintosh Apple
  • 1 Granny Smith Apple
HARDWARE:
  • 5-10 Gal. Ice Chest/Cooler
  • Digital Probe Thermometer w/alarm

Instructions:

  1. 24 hours before cooking, combine 1 LB of kosher salt, 1 carton chicken stock, pepper corns, teriyaki sauce, brown sugar, and half a head of pealed and smashed garlic in a heavy pot. Place over high heat until everything is dissolved, stirring often. About 15 – 20 minutes.
  2. Using the cooler, combine the hot liquid with ice, apple juice, and remaining chicken stock. Let set for 10 minutes to cool.
  3. Stir well and then add the thawed turkey, breast side down. If the turkey floats place a heavy object on top such as a casserole dish. Turkey must be completely submerged.
  4. Day of preparation, preheat your oven to 500 degrees and remove your turkey from the brine, rinse with cool water and pat dry with paper towels. Turkey should be as dry as possible.
  5. Slice apples and onions into quarters and place in turkey cavity with remaining pealed and lightly crushed garlic.
  6. Lightly spread oil on turkey skin.
  7. Fold a piece of heavy duty aluminum foil into a triangle and form over breast of turkey, kind of like making a breast plate. Then remove foil and set aside.
  8. lightly sprinkle turkey with kosher salt.
  9. Place probe thermometer in the middle of the thickest part of the breast meat and set alarm for 161. Cook turkey at 500 for 20 minutes or until golden brown.
  10. Remove from oven and replace the turkey armor you made earlier.
  11. Reduce heat to 350.
  12. Let oven cool 10 minutes then return bird to heat. Cook until thermometer sounds.
  13. Remove from oven and let rest covered by another sheet of heavy duty aluminum foil for 30 minutes.
  14. Discard apple and onion bits from cavity. Carve, serve, and enjoy.
  15. Mix garlic from roasted turkey with butter until well blended.
  16. Spread on toasted french bread, lightly sprinkle with salt & freshly cracked black pepper.

Prep Time : 24 hr.
Cook Time: 1-2 hrs depending on bird and oven
